The sale will be held in this fascinating and historic Museum. They are selecting items from their extensive collections to offer to the public as a means to raise funds for the society. In Sept 1982 the building was placed on the National Register for Historic Places.
The Carondelet Historic Center Building opened in 1873 as the Des Peres School which housed the first publicly funded Kindergarten in the United States founded by Susan Blow.The Museum was founded in 1967. It is quite an amazing place!

The Tour Includes:
Susan Blow Kindergarten - Recreation of the Susan Blow Kindergarten complete with old school furniture and period books etc..It was the first continuous public school kindergarten in the United States! Founded Sept 1973 in the DePeres school by Miss Susan E Blow.
The Cleveland Room. This year marks the 100th Anniversary of Cleveland High School in St Louis, Mo. It houses artifacts from the school.You will see the YALE BOWL team pictures, sports, academic and club trophies.
Wall of Honor - On display are over 1,300 pictures of veterans from the Civil War to Present conflicts.
Memory Lane Room - Street of St Louis Storefronts from the 19th and 20th Century including a collection of Antique Dolls from around the world, toys, tools , interactive train layout with two running trains, and an old fashioned meat markets with original fixtures. Old erector set Ferris Wheel that works!
Heritage Room - Victorian Era housewares from the Carondelet Area, Early Victorian Carondelet bedroom, music display and a special exhibit of Vintage Clothing. 1904 Worlds Fair Items are also featured.
Art gallery -features local Carondelet Artists
Frederick Bouchein Library and Archives containing the CHS archives and collections of historic documents, genealogical reources, 1870-1985 City directories, Delor Family Papers (founder of Carondelet in 1767)
